Diagnostic imaging, also called medical imaging, is an advanced technique and process of creating visual representations using electromagnetic radiation for viewing interior body organs for medical intervention and clinical analysis. This type of imaging technology produces images of internal structures hidden by skin and bones, which enables accurate diagnosis and treatment. Also, its ability to establish database of normal anatomy and physiology makes it possible to identify abnormalities easily and at an early stage. Diagnostic imaging techniques include X-ray radiography, magnetic resonance imaging (MRI), medical ultrasonography or ultrasound, endoscopy, elastography, tactile imaging, thermography, medical photography, and nuclear medicine functional imaging techniques, etc.
Market drivers include growing geriatric population, rising prevalence of chronic diseases, rising awareness regarding the benefits of early diagnosis of diseases, and technological advancements in diagnostic imaging techniques.
Factors restraining market growth include high risk of radiation exposure, regulatory hurdles and challenges, high cost associated with installation, and shortage of helium for magnetic resonance imaging systems.
